Matheus Oliveira is a 28-year-old football player who plays as a striker for FC Anyang, born on September 28, 1997, who is left-footed. In the 2026 K-League 1 season, Matheus Oliveira has recorded 3 goals, 2 assists, 522 minutes, an average FotMob rating of 7.17.
Matheus Oliveira scores highly on Assists, Matches, and Goals compared to strikers in the K-League 1.

Matheus Oliveira's career has also included time at Sao Bernardo, Inter de Limeira, Mirassol, Agua Santa, Remo, Atletico GO, Brasil de Pelotas, Osasco Sporting, Ponte Preta, Guarani, Red Bull Brasil, and Santos FC.

Throughout their career, Matheus Oliveira has won 2 titles: K League 2 (2024) with FC Anyang and Serie C (2022) with Mirassol.
